The Triumph of Jesus: A Song of Victory and Redemption

The song 'Vencedor' by Lagoinha One is a powerful anthem of faith and victory, celebrating the supremacy and triumph of Jesus Christ. The lyrics emphasize the reverence and awe that Jesus commands, stating that every knee will bow and every tongue will confess His name. This imagery is drawn from biblical passages, particularly Philippians 2:10-11, which speaks of the universal acknowledgment of Jesus' lordship. The song underscores the power of Jesus' name, describing it as mighty and capable of overcoming all adversaries.

The chorus of the song repeatedly declares Jesus as the 'Vencedor' (Victor), highlighting His position above all names and His place at the right hand of God the Father. This is a reference to the exaltation of Jesus after His resurrection, as described in Christian theology. The lyrics also speak of Jesus' victory over death and pain, emphasizing His role as a savior who has conquered all that was against humanity. This victory is not just a historical event but a personal one, as the song mentions that Jesus has taken away the singer's sins and given them a new identity through His sacrifice.

The song's message is one of hope and assurance, reminding believers of the transformative power of Jesus' sacrifice and His ultimate victory. It encourages listeners to find strength and confidence in their faith, knowing that Jesus has already won the battle against sin and death. The repetition of the phrase 'Vencedor tu és' (You are the Victor) serves as a powerful affirmation of Jesus' eternal reign and His ability to bring redemption and new life to those who believe in Him.
